Ambien is a non-benzodiazepine hypnotic drug used for insomnia. It has fast effects and usually works within 15 minutes, but does not have the ability to keep a person sleeping, just initiating it. It is a drug also used for other brain disorders and is often used for a short term time span of two to six weeks. The side effects of Ambien are serious and its usage needs to be closely monitored by a doctor.
Several users of Ambien have stopped using it as they find out that the hypnotic effects of the drug actually cause them to get up in the night and do things that they don't remember the next day. changes in behavior and thought patterns are a part of this side effect. Some people drive somewhere like the store and buy food, go home and cook and never remember doing it. The evidence is there the next day or a loved one saw them get up and leave. This is a dangerous side-effect of Ambien and the doses of it need to be right and monitored closely, to know what a person can handle.
A person may experience bitter hallucinations or delusions that cause confusion and problems in their life. A patient must report these side effects right away to their health care professional.
Either nausea or increased hunger can be a side effect of Ambien and one or the other is not healthy. Several of the sleepwalkers will get up and fix all kinds of food, even cooking a meal and eating, then go back to bed and not remember doing it.
Another side effect of Ambien can be frequent headaches that increase over time. This is something also to report right away to your doctor as you may need to switch to another medication.
Ambien can cause physical dependence on it and a rebound effect of insomnia when stopped. It is advised that Ambien not be used more than 12 weeks at the most and the amounts and days should be determined carefully. Withdrawals will be the result of the addiction and will have to be closely monitored by a doctor.
